Who would benefit from this Seminar:
Designers, OEM's, Integrators and Research Faculty in the Lab Automation, Life Sciences, Medical, Biotech, Semiconductor, Pharmaceutical, Optics, Photonics, Metrology & Microscopy, Material Science, Test & Measurement, and General Automation markets who are looking to gain a better practical understanding of how to design, integrate & program a high precision linear motion control system.
The Seminar agenda includes presentations on:
• How to size & select single & multi-axis linear motion systems
• Open loop vs. closed loop systems
• Common methods of control: LabVIEW, Zaber's Console, Joystick, etc.
• Using LabVIEW in motion applications
• Vacuum compatible actuators & positioning systems
• 'Hands-on' assembly of a Zaber linear system
• Benefits of adding feedback loops and load sensors to linear systems
• Chat with an engineer to solve your toughest motion control problem
• Product Demonstrations
